When selecting an extractor fan for an island, particular functions must be prioritized to guarantee performance and efficiency:
Extraction Rate: Measured in cubic feet per minute (CFM), this suggests the volume of air the fan can move. Greater CFM is typically better for larger areas.Noise Level: Measured in sones; quieter fans offer a more enjoyable cooking environment.Filters: Charcoal Filters: Ideal for recirculating models.Aluminum or Stainless Steel Filters: Better for ducted systems, washable, and more long lasting.Ducted vs. Ductless: Ducted fans vent air outside, while ductless fans filter and recirculate air. Ducted systems are typically more effective for heavy cooking.Controls: Options like push-button control or touch controls can boost user experience.Setup Process

Q1: How do I figure out the right size of the extractor fan for my island?A: The right size frequently depends upon the cooking practices and size of the kitchen. A typical guideline is to intend for a CFM score of at least 100 for each linear foot of the cooktop. Q2: Can I set up an island extractor fan

myself?A: While some house owners might select to DIY, it is recommended to hire experts for setup, specifically for ducted systems that need precise positioning and electrical work. Q3: How typically should I replace filters in my extractor fan?A: Charcoal filters
generally need to be changed every 6 months, while metal filters can often be cleaned up rather than changed. Q4: Are island extractor fans efficient for big kitchens?A: Yes, when selected properly, island extractor fans can efficiently aerate big kitchen areas. It's important to select a fan with a higher CFM for optimum performance.
